Ticket #— Floor 9 Opening Prep, Brindlemoor House

Hi facilities folks, Floor 9 opens to staff next Monday and we need a few things squared away before then. Lift access is live, but the two side doors by the kitchenette are still on the old lock config — please reprogram them before Friday. Also, signage for the quiet rooms hasn't arrived, so pop up the temporary printed ones for now. Until the badge readers sync, the interim door code for Floor 9 is below.

door code, bajop-bajog: bdg-DSWAC-43621

Hey — handing off FeedGull, our podcast feed validator, while I'm out. It checks RSS/Atom feeds for missing enclosures, bad durations, and broken artwork refs. Runs nightly plus on-demand. Most tickets are publishers with malformed pubDate fields; there's a canned response template for that. If the validator itself crashes, it's almost always the XML parser choking on weird encodings — just requeue the feed. Everything else you need, including the queue dashboard and triage steps, lives on the internal page below.

wiki page, tahaf-tajog: https://jira.ordindyn.corp/pipeline

During the great leaked-file-descriptor hunt of last quarter, we set up a dedicated service account so the Fennelworks probe daemon could pull open-handle stats from Burrow, our internal metrics service. Future maintainers: don't reuse this account for anything else, it's scoped read-only on purpose. If the daemon logs auth failures, the credential below is the one to check first.

gateway credential: kto3_qfe